Phys.org Argues Social Media Ban for Teenagers Misses the Point of Addiction

via Phys.org·Apr 1

Researchers argue that banning social media for teenagers fails to address the root causes of digital addiction and mental health struggles. The article highlights personal stories, such as Taylor Little's, where addiction led to the loss of entire developmental years despite platform restrictions. Experts suggest that comprehensive mental health support and digital literacy education are more effective solutions than simple bans.
